What's XRP, you ask?
Think of it as a smooth operator in the digital payment game. XRP is designed to make sending and receiving money across borders as easy as sending a text. It's all about speed, efficiency, and keeping those pesky fees at bay.
Why so special, XRP?
Well, buckle up for some mind-blowing facts:
- Lightning speed: XRP transactions can zip through in a matter of seconds, leaving traditional payment methods in the dust.
- Super-low fees: Tired of those annoying transfer fees? XRP's got your back with its tiny transaction costs.
- Global reach: No matter where you or your money are, XRP can connect you across borders like a boss.
- Green credentials: XRP is an eco-friendly crypto, so you can feel good about using it without guilt.

XRP in the spotlight: real-world use cases
XRP isn't just some abstract concept; it's already making waves in various industries:
- Remittances: Sending money to loved ones overseas? XRP can make it a breeze, saving you time and money.
- Cross-border payments: Businesses can use XRP to streamline their international transactions, cutting costs and speeding up the process.
- Supply chain management: Tracking goods and optimizing supply chains? XRP can play a vital role in enhancing efficiency and transparency.
